Bestway offers retailers Jisp shopping app for consumers

Bestway Wholesale has announced a partnership with Jisp – an award-winning shopping and payment app – to provide its franchise and symbol retailers with the opportunity to offer their customers home delivery and click & collect services. 

The Jisp app is currently being trialled within the Bestway estate and is expected to be made available free of charge to all of Bestway’s retailers in the New Year. 

Managing director Dawood Pervez said that there is a real need to support retail businesses with ‘best-in-class’ technology that is easy to use for both the retailer and the consumer – technology that each retailer may not be able to afford individually.

“There is huge opportunity for UK convenience retailers. Research undertaken in May shows that during the lockdown, over 26% of the UK population used c-stores for home delivery or click & collect. Furthermore, according to the ACS (Association of Convenience Stores), 57% of retailers have launched home delivery services in one form or another, since the pandemic took hold. 

“Our partnership with Jisp is designed to empower our partners by giving them functionality that goes beyond the very basic order capture system and enables them to compete with the best in the business.  It can be accessed through smart/mobile technology – which everyone is now familiar with using – making it very easy for consumers to use the app.” 

Pervez added: “Retailers will be able to understand their customers better in terms of products and range and individual preferences, helping them to upsell and grow sales.”

Bestway Wholesale supplies over 50,000 retailers, covering company-owned stores, franchise stores, symbol group, retail club and independent retailers.
